This recipe was extracted from Original White House Cookbook (1887) by Hugo Ziemann, F. L. Gillette, Hugo Zimmerman, mrs gillette, page 165.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.
WAFFLES. Take a quart of flour and wet it with a little sweet milk that has been boiled and cooled, then stir in enough of the milk to form a thick batter. Add a tablespoonful of melted butter, a teaspoonful of salt, and yeast to raise it. When light add two well-beaten eggs
